flag UK students increasingly rely on side hustles for income, driven by financial need and skill development.

flag A 2025 survey of UK students finds 65% now have a side hustle or part-time job, nearly double the 38% in the 1980s. flag Common roles include retail, hospitality, online tutoring, delivery driving, and selling goods online, with about 30% earning through e-commerce. flag Unusual gigs like posing as a football mascot or standing in lines for others are also reported. flag Financial need is the main driver, though many seek skill-building or hobby monetization. flag Nearly a third work 11 or more hours weekly, a drop from 1990s levels. flag Experts say side hustles have become vital for long-term financial planning.
